Migrate Polylang to WPML

Import multilingual data from Polylang to WPML

Installation and usage

  • Backup your database! There is a reason why this plugin has the version number 0.1
  • Deactivate Polylang.
  • Activate both WPML Multilingual Blog/CMS and the (Migrate Polylang to WPML) plugins. If you also want to migrate string translations, activate WPML String Translation plugin.
  • Finish the WPML Wizard (you will see it right after activation)
  • If you have custom post types, go to WPML > Translation options (or WPML > Translation Management > Multilingual Content Setup) and set those types to be translatable.
  • Go to Tools > Migrate from Polylang to WPML
  • Click button "Migrate" and wait until the migration process is completed (it might take longer based on the size of the content you are migrating)
  • Done. You can uninstall the (Migrate Polylang to WPML) plugin.

What this plugin does

  • Configures WPML to have the same languages as they were in Polylang.
  • Migrates all your posts, pages and custom post types and their translations.
  • Migrates all your taxonomies (categories, tags and custom taxonomies) and their translations.
  • Migrates your strings (only those which has been translated in Polylang and WPMl String Translation recognized and registered as correct string)
  • Migrate widgets: You will need to activate WPML Widgets plugin.

What this plugin doesn't (yet)

  • Migrate menus: Use the menu synchronization between languages option in WPML.
  • Migrate other settings: This will be implemented progressively. For the time being, you are free to adjust them manually after the migration process is completed.
